Question

Dans GVim, j'utilise une police de type fixsys qui a l'air bien, mais avec le texte en italique, elle se casse (caractères partiellement illisibles, en particulier le dernier en italique si le suivant est normal).

Pour cette raison (et parce que je n'aime pas le texte en italique de toute façon), j'aimerais complètement désactiver le texte en italique dans Vim ;sans modifier aucune syntaxe mettant en évidence les fichiers associés.

Était-ce utile?

La solution

Le fait que la coloration syntaxique utilise ou non du texte en italique est défini par votre schéma de couleurs.N'importe quelle règle de schéma de couleurs peut définir term, cterm, et/ou gui les listes d'attributs, qui sont décrites dans : aide attr-liste.Vous pouvez soit effacer les règles de couleurs pertinentes, soit supprimer le italic attribut d'eux.

Par exemple, si la règle suivante figure dans votre palette de couleurs

hi IncSearch gui=italic guifg=#303030 guibg=#cd8b60

vous voudriez simplement supprimer le gui=italic peu.Vous pouvez également spécifier de ne pas utiliser les attributs de attr-list en définissant gui=NONE.

Autres conseils

Lorsque vous utilisez le très recommandé thème solarisé , vous pouvez configurer cette utilisation en utilisant:

let g:solarized_italic=0

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top